| <script type="text/x-red" data-help-name="rawserial in">
 | |
|     <p><b>DEPERECATED :</b> Rawseerial is now deprecated as the serialport npm now provide pre-compiled binaries for Windows.</p>
 | |
|     <p>Uses a simple read of the serial port as a file to input data.</p>
 | |
|     <p>You MUST set the baud rate etc <i>externally</i> before starting Node-RED. For example.</p>
 | |
|     <p>Windows<pre>mode COM1:9600,n,8,1</pre>
 | |
|     <p>Linux<pre>stty -F /dev/ttyUSB0 9600</pre>
 | |
|     <p>Note: This node does not implement pooling of connections so only one instance of each port may be used - so in OR out but NOT both.</p>
 | |
|     <p>Should only really be used if you can't get npm serialport installed properly.</p>
 | |
| </script>
